Rick Wright’s Greenville Triumph remain undefeated this season after a 3-2 win away to One Knoxville in the Lamar Hunt US Open Cup second round yesterday [April 3]. It took a stoppage-time goal from Chapa Herrera to ensure Greenville’s safe passage to the third round of the competition. Lyam MacKinnon scored twice for Greenville. The PHC Zebras defended their premier division title after defeating the North Village Rams 3 – 2 at the Flora Duffy South Field Stadium at the National Sports Center. Jalen Harvey gave the North Village Rams the lead in the 4th minute when he met a Troy Tucker free kick at the back post. The North Village Rams would take that lead to the break. David Bascome’s Baltimore Blast defeated Utica City FC 15-10 at home in the Major Arena Soccer League on Saturday [March 30]. The win follows on from Baltimore’s 6-5 victory away to Harrisburg Heat last Wednesday. Baltimore finish the season in fifth place in the Eastern Division with 11 wins from 24 matches. [Updated with video] Nahki Wells scored the winning goal in Bristol City’s 1-0 victory away to Plymouth Argyle in the Sky Bet Championship today [April 1]. It was the Bermudian’s first goal since scoring in a 2-2 draw away to Coventry City in the league on January 30. [Written by Stephen Wright] Kacy Milan Butterfield has revealed he has taken a break from international duty as he focuses on revitalising his club career in England. He has not featured for Bermuda since starting Michael Findlay’s first game as head coach, a goalless draw at home to French Guiana in the Concacaf Nations League in September last year.
